Output 61e33950fc8d54f0ba80ae2b8315cacfe0bea6f592b1de56c1f937e6a0712ae4:1

value
2560586
script pubkey
OP_0 OP_PUSHBYTES_20 0f4f43e4a2a5cee40e05fe403ee0cf176b00212a
address
bc1qpa858e9z5h8wgrs9leqracx0za4sqgf2fd8xrc
transaction
61e33950fc8d54f0ba80ae2b8315cacfe0bea6f592b1de56c1f937e6a0712ae4
spent
true